Welcome to the Pebbletide client team! One thing you'll review a lot: the image cache in `GlimmerCache.swift` has a known leak where decoded bitmaps aren't released when a scroll view is torn down mid-flight. We patched it twice; it came back twice. So when reviewing PRs that touch cache eviction, check for retain cycles in the completion handlers. Diagnostics for this live in a sealed profiling bundle, and to open it you'll need the recovery passphrase noted just below.

unlock words, hahip-baduf: holwyn-istath-julvan

## Formula sandbox tuning

User-supplied formulas in Gridmoor execute inside a restricted interpreter with hard ceilings on time, memory, and call depth. Reviewers should confirm any change to these ceilings is justified in the PR description, since raising them widens the abuse surface. Defaults were chosen from production traces. The current limits are as follows.

limits module of tafog-fawip:
WEIGHTS = {
    "julix": 57,
    "lamys": 992,
    "kasvan": 209,
    "quenok": 750,
    "alddor": 259,
    "oliath": 1009,
    "wenix": 815,
}

Ticket #— Floor 9 Opening Prep, Brindlemoor House

Hi facilities folks, Floor 9 opens to staff next Monday and we need a few things squared away before then. Lift access is live, but the two side doors by the kitchenette are still on the old lock config — please reprogram them before Friday. Also, signage for the quiet rooms hasn't arrived, so pop up the temporary printed ones for now. Until the badge readers sync, the interim door code for Floor 9 is below.

door code, bajop-bajog: bdg-DSWAC-43621

## Rotabot Onboarding Note (Weekly Eng Sync)

Rotabot is our internal secrets-rotation utility. It rotates credentials on a fixed schedule and writes an audit entry for every rotation. This week we're onboarding the payments team, so expect extra audit volume. Rotation state and audit logs live in a dedicated store. To verify rotations locally, connect with the following connection string.

primary connection of yagep-kahip = redis://giliel_svc:zYiKsLL2PLpfPL@db-348f.xolmarsys.corp:5432/fenwyn